Managers lead shifts every week, ensuring customers get a fast, accurate, friendly experience. A Shift Manager provides leadership to crew and other managers to ensure great quality, service, and cleanliness.
Shift Managers perform tasks such as planning for each shift, monitoring performance, taking action to maintain standards, monitoring safety, security, and profitability, and communicating with the next shift manager. They may also be responsible for meeting targets and helping departments meet goals.
Starting pay for this position is $13.00/hr. Previous leadership experience preferred, ideally within a restaurant, retail or hospitality environment. We look for positive team players with a flexible schedule who like to work in a fast‑paced McDonald’s environment. Must be 18 years or older to be a manager in a corporate‑owned restaurant.
